Luxembourg Wins One!

Image Copyright © Getty Images

The Luxembourg national team have won a World Cup qualifying match during my lifetime! Woohoo! Details can be found at the UEFA website here.

Good luck, boys! I know it's a longshot, but I hope to see you in South Africa in 2010!


Popular Posts